Hello

Is it possible to officially add a black list to your own lists?
I want to prevent certain mangas I already decided not to touch to appear in my searches again and again (and I can't remember all their names to I often ended up clicking on them again).

Currently I'm using the feature to add custom lists (I've a list named Black List), in the search I usually mark 'exclude mangas from my lists', but that however marks mangas I moved to my black list as 'reading' (same icon). It sometimes confuses me when I check out mangakas.

So this solution I chose with the current possibilities given doesn't fully please me.

Giving the option to add a different icon to own created lists would be a help too (can be a set of icons you add to choose from - so ppl wouldn't need to upload own ones).
But an official feature for a black list would be best of course (incl.the option to disable black listed mangas to appear in searches).

Hope you get what I mean.
